Fault Description:
Data Acquisition Unit (DAU) 1 is reporting that the Hydraulic System1 fluid quantity is below the recommended level in relation to the temperature and aircraft configuration. Refer to the table below:
| HYDRAULIC FLUID TEMPERATURE | QUANTITY |
|---|---|
| ≥-40°C to ≤-17°C | <23% |
| -16°C to ≤4°C | <34% |
| 5°C to ≤26°C | <43% |
| 27°C to ≤49°C | <52% |
| 50°C to ≤71°C | <62% |
| 72°C to ≤93°C | <70% |
| Aircraft Condition: Weight on Wheels, system pressurized above 2600 psi and condition set for more than 2 minutes. | |
Possible Causes:
- Data Acquisition Unit (DAU) 1 (A17)
- Hydraulic System 1 Reservoir Quantity Transducer (MT139)
- Associated Wiring

Troubleshooting Recommendations:
NOTE: An engine run-up may be required to verify for a leak at the EDP drain mast.
NOTE: For a suspected component leak in the wings, a fuel sample may be required and send to a lab to verify for content of hydraulic fluid in the fuel.
- Ensure Hydraulic System 1 is properly serviced.
- If quantity is good, go to step 3.
- If system low quantity found, continue with next step.
- Service the system and check for leaks.
- If no leaks are noted, do close out.
- If leaks are noted, continue with next step.
- Swap DAU 1 with DAU 2.
- If system checks are good, replace DAU 1 and do close out.
- If fault remains, continue with next step.
- Perform wiring check between hydraulic system 1 reservoir quantity transducer and DAU 1.
- If wiring checks are not good, repair defective wiring as required and do close out.
- If wiring checks are good, continue with next step.
- Carry out an external visual check of the hydraulic system which includes all lines and their component(s). Replace as necessary.
- If faults are found/repaired and message clears, do close out.
- If wiring checks are good, continue with next step.
- Replace Hydraulic Reservoir 1.
- Do close out.
